I have a very annoying problem with the new security light i have just purchased and fitted.
I wired the light from the mini consumer unit in my garage.
I took a feed from the lighting circuit to a switch and then to the security light.
All works fine as a security PIR i.e. when it senses movement it comes on for a minute and then goes off.
The light is supposed to have a manual over ride facility (discussed on other forum topics on this website) whereby if you turn the switch for the light on/off within 1 secod the light remains on permanently.
The other half wants this facility for when we have family bbq's etc.
I just cannot make the manual over ride facility work. When i flick the switch on/off and on, the light comes on for a min then goes off.
Have i missed something simple ?
